  "account": "KUALA LUMPUR, Aug 11 — Malaysia is prepared to amplify and deepen its defence collaboration with Iran, rooted in the enduring friendship shared between the two nations. This stance was articulated by Defence Minister Datuk Seri Mohamed Khaled Nordin during a telephone chat with Iran’s Deputy Minister of Defence and Logistics, Brigadier General Seyed Majid Ebn-e-Reza. In a subsequent Facebook update, he expressed hope for the formalisation of a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to cement defence ties between Malaysia and Iran. \"I also commended Iran's involvement in next year's Langkawi International Maritime and Aerospace Exhibition (LIMA) as a means to further bolster relations and explore additional defence cooperation,\" Nordin added.\n\nIn his condolence message to Iran, Mohamed Khaled acknowledged the loss of Iranian leaders, security personnel, and civilians during the conflict in West Asia. He emphasized Malaysia's desire to see a ceasefire preserved and the ongoing pursuit of dialogue and diplomatic resolutions for the sake of regional peace and stability. Nordin highlighted Iran's resilience, including its domestically developed defence capabilities. He also appreciated Iran's cooperation and kindness during the conflict, underscoring the importance of safeguarding maritime routes, such as the Strait of Hormuz, for the security of the region.",
